追N量及播量对BNS型杂交小麦产量的影响 被引量:3

Effect of nitrogen fertilizer rate and planting density on yield of BNS hybrid wheat varieties

摘要 为探讨BNS型杂交小麦的高产配套技术,试验采用正交设计方法,研究了BNS型杂交小麦的N肥追施量与播量对产量及成产因素的影响.结果表明:品种间的产量及成产因素有极显著差异,对越冬期的追N量也较为敏感,但品种与施N量互作对产量的影响不大.BNS型杂交小麦对播量的反应不敏感,说明其播量弹性较大,基本苗在9万。21万/666.7m2范围内,其产量差异不显著.通过方差分析可知,BNS型杂交小麦的最佳组合分别为:杂麦4号产量最高的组合为A1B4C4,即选择越冬期追施5.5kg纯N,保证18万基本苗;杂麦3号产量最高的组合为A2B2C4,即在18万基本苗的条件下越冬期追施2.5kg纯N;杂交小麦百杂1001产量最高的组合为A3B42C1,苗期仅需9万基本苗,追施2.5kg的纯N即可取得最好的产量. Effects of N fertilizer and planting density on the yield and its factors of BNS hybrid wheat varities were studied in order to the integrate high-yield technique for BNS hybrid wheat,and the optimization test scheme was adopted.The results showed that the yield and its factors had evident difference in different varieties and more sensitive to nitrogen fertilizer rate during overwintering period,but the influence between varieties and nitrogen fertilizer rate on variety was not too important.The insensitivity of BNS hybrid wheat to planting density explained their elasticity of sowing quantities was bigger, the difference of yield was not significant within the scope of 9x]04~ 21 xl04 basic seedling per 666.7mZ.Through the variance analysis,the optimal combination of BNS hybrid wheat respectively:the highest yield combination of Zamai 4 was AIB4C4 which choosing 5.5 kg N and 18 xl04 basic seedling per 666.7m2; the optimal treatment of Zamai 3 was A2B2C4; the best combination of Baiza 1001 was A3B2C.
